Aggregate Crushing Strength Test
Jun 27, 2020The crushing strength or aggregate crushing value of a given road aggregate is found out as per IS-2386 Part- 4. The aggregate crushing value provides a relative measure of resistance to crushing under a gradually applied compressive load. To achieve a high quality of pavement aggregate possessing low aggregate crushing value should be preferred. Get price

Standard Test Method for Compressive Strength of Hydraulic
This test method covers determination of the compressive strength of hydraulic cement mortars, using 2-in. or [50 mm] cube specimens. NOTE 1-Test Method C349 provides an alternative procedure for this determination (not to be used for acceptance tests). This test method covers the application of the test using either inch-pound or SI units. Get price
